Funny Fables Brimming with Mirth & Legend

A collection of 26 short stories from the winning writers, shortlisted entrants and judges of the 2015 To Hull & Back humorous short story contest.

"A brilliant mix of humour in bite size stories. I keep chuckling to myself on the train to work... people are starting to look at me strangely." Review from Amazon.co.uk customer

The stories in this book are fun and quirky, written by writers with vivid imaginations. Each is likely to become a fable of mirth and legend in the near future.

The anthology was first released on Hulloween 2015. The winner's copy of the book has made a journey on the Highway to Hull, strapped to a two-wheeled chariot of rampant noisiness.
